LH2 can work well for commercial shipping. Use at pace of boil off. Ammonia toxicity is a bit overblown. The tiniest leak will smell strongly, and it leaks as a gas. The smell threshold is far below toxicity level. Go outside is a natural solution.

Ammonia and LH2 have tradeoffs. Compressed H2 in "trimaran pontoons" is an excellent solution that would permit sail assist as well. Nuclear is too expensive.
